NNZ guide to the level required in the YoYo test is:
| Umpires prior to screening for NZ A, B or C (Qualifying), including endorsement | LEVEL 14.3 |
| All Umpires applying for NNZ events (e.g. U17, U19, NZSS) | 14.5 |
| All other umpires recommended levels | 13.2 |

Introduction Workshops for Umpire Coaches are Underway
On Sunday 26 March 6 new Umpire Coaches from Cluster 2 attended the Introductory Coach Assessor Workshop at Otorohanga Netball Centre. Under the guidance of Marrianne Walton, a NWBOP trained facilitator, these new Umpire Coaches covered Umpire Centre Learning: what the role of the coach, assessor and mentor looks like; coaching terminology; how to analyse an umpire’s performance and post-match discussion between the umpire and the coach.
One of the WBOP key priorities in 2017 is to have more qualified umpires and another is to then ensure we have more accredited umpire coaches to assist these umpires in their development. Well done to all of those who were part of this workshop.
